Photo angles greatly affect how we perceive a scene. The shooting angle shapes the photo’s story, its atmosphere, and the viewer’s reaction to the scene. A low shot can make the subject look more powerful and expressive, while a high shot can make the subject look more humble or fragile. Shooting from side angles gives a sense of depth and perspective, allowing the viewer to look at the scene from a different angle. Also, shooting from the front or back of the subject can create a sense of mystery or make the viewer part of the story. Different angles, combined with the play of light and shadow, can set the emotional tone of a photograph.
